Who it's for
Is microneedling right for you?
Microneedling doesn't add anything to your skin: it convinces your skin to rebuild itself, which is why the results look and age like you. It shines on texture problems: scarring, roughness, enlarged pores, fine lines. For pigment-first concerns like sun spots, light-based treatments usually beat needles. If that's your situation, we'll say so and point you there.
- Acne scars (rolling, shallow or boxcar)
- Rough or uneven texture that makeup exaggerates
- Enlarged pores and early fine lines
- An all-over collagen rebuild as skin thins with time
How microneedling works & what to expect
Consult & numb. We assess your skin and goals, then numb for about 30 minutes, the comfort step.
Treat. The SkinPen passes over the treatment area, its needle depth adjusted zone by zone to your skin and concern: about 20–30 minutes.
Rebuild. A day or two of sunburn-pink, then collagen builds quietly for weeks. The series compounds: most plans run 3–6 sessions a month apart.
What to know
Microneedling risks, downtime & aftercare
Expect 24–48 hours of redness like a mild sunburn, sometimes with light flaking or pinpoint dryness after. Skin is more sun-sensitive during a series, so SPF is non-negotiable. Active breakouts, some skin conditions and certain medications need clearance first, which is what the intake review is for.
Microneedling with PRF
PRF is the classic microneedling amplifier and it is on our menu: a small draw of your own blood, spun gently to concentrate platelets and growth factors into golden PRF, then worked into the fresh micro-channels while they are still open. The growth factors land exactly where the needling made room for them and release over the following days, which is why the pairing does more for scarring and overall skin quality than needling alone.
Microneedling with exosomes
Exosomes are the newer option and usually what we reach for first: concentrated growth-factor signals delivered into the same channels, without the blood draw or the preparation time. The pairing helps scars generally (acne, surgical or otherwise), and most patients who try an exosome session make it their default. Both are available, and which one earns its place in your plan comes down to your skin, your scarring and how you feel about the draw.
Microneedling for acne scars
Acne scars are the concern microneedling was practically built for: each pass breaks up tethered scar tissue while triggering new collagen underneath, so rolling and shallow scars gradually fill and smooth from within. Progress is real but gradual: plan on a series, with photos along the way, and deeper ice-pick scars sometimes needing a layered approach we'll map at consult.

Common questions
Microneedling FAQs
Does microneedling hurt?
With proper numbing (30 minutes, part of every appointment), most patients describe vibration and a scratching sensation rather than pain, with some sensitive spots near bone. Appointments run 30–60 minutes all in.
How many sessions will I need?
Three to six for most goals, spaced about a month apart. General texture and glow sit at the lower end; established acne scarring at the upper. You’ll see the trajectory by session two.
When will I see results?
The first glow appears within a week of each session, but the real product (new collagen) builds over two to six weeks and compounds across the series.
What’s the downtime, really?
A day or two of sunburn-pink and warmth, then possibly light flaking. Most patients treat on Friday and wear makeup again by Sunday. We ask for 24 hours bare-skinned first.

Is this the same as an at-home dermaroller?
No. Home rollers legally stop at depths that don’t reach where collagen is made, and reusing them carries real infection risk. We use the SkinPen, the FDA-cleared medical microneedling device, with sterile single-use tips and needle depth adjusted per area of your face.
